Texas Ventures Acquisition III Corp (TVA) closed at $10.49, unchanged on the session, as the stock remained near the middle of its recent range between support at $9.97 and resistance at $11.01. The lack of price movement suggests traders are waiting for catalyst-driven activity in this special purpose acquisition company.

In the broader SPAC sector, many blank-check companies have experienced muted trading in recent weeks as regulatory uncertainty and a slower pace of de-SPAC transactions weigh on investor sentiment. TVA, which has yet to announce a definitive business combination target, is typical of pre-merger SPACs that often trade near their trust value. The current price sits roughly 5.2% above the support level of $9.97 and about 2.9% below the resistance at $11.01, indicating a relatively tight trading band. Without any company-specific news or a definitive agreement, the stock’s movement continues to be influenced by sector-wide trends rather than fundamental developments. Looking ahead, TVA’s outlook hinges on the SPAC’s ability to identify and announce a merger target. Without a definitive agreement, the stock may continue to trade in the narrow range between support and resistance. If market conditions for SPACs improve or if the company provides an update on its search, the price could potentially challenge the upper resistance at $11.01. Conversely, a lack of progress or broader negative sentiment in the SPAC space might cause the stock to test the support at $9.97. Factors that could influence future performance include shifts in regulatory guidelines for de-SPAC transactions, the pace of redemptions, and general risk appetite among investors.
